Waterproof Outdoor Dog Carrier Sourcing Guide

Waterproof outdoor dog carriers sit at the intersection of pet travel gear and weather-exposed equipment, which makes them a category where material claims and structural quality matter as much as price. Buyers sourcing these products for retail, e-commerce, or private-label programs should treat waterproofing as a testable specification rather than a marketing label, since outdoor use exposes seams, zippers, and base panels to sustained moisture. The listings observed in this category cover shoulder-style carriers intended for dogs, cats, small animals, and even reptiles, with sizes ranging from S to L and one-size formats, so scope definition is the first sourcing decision.

This guide walks through the full procurement cycle: interpreting listing signals, verifying technical specifications, confirming compliance documentation, understanding cost and commercial terms, qualifying manufacturers, and planning long-term reorders. Throughout, the emphasis is on asking suppliers for evidence — material composition, load ratings, water-resistance methodology — before committing to volume. Buyers who anchor negotiations in verifiable specifications consistently avoid the two most common failures in this category: carriers that leak at seams after light rain, and shoulder straps or base panels that fail well below the stated maximum weight capacity.

Technical Specifications to Verify

Begin with materials and construction. Observed material references include polyester, and one listing specifies bonded fabric with needled cotton lining, while another references polyester/PVC construction — a meaningful difference, since PVC-coated polyester generally delivers more reliable water shedding than uncoated woven fabric. Buyers should request the exact fabric weight, coating type, and seam-sealing method, and should ask whether zippers and stitching lines are treated with water-resistant tape or flaps. The stated maximum weight range of 3–10 kg should be verified against actual load testing of the base panel and shoulder strap anchor points, not assumed.

Second, verify size and fit engineering. With S, M, L, and one-size variants in the category, confirm internal dimensions, ventilation openings, and closure security for the target animal weight and body length. Net weight observations of 0.23–0.28 kg, 0.30 kg, and 0.95 kg show substantial variation in construction heft, which correlates with durability but also with shipping cost. Where listings claim waterproof status, ask the supplier to describe the test method behind the claim; where a listing states "not waterproof," treat that as honest scoping and plan water exposure accordingly rather than negotiating the claim upward.

Compliance and Safety Documentation

Compliance documentation should be requested before sampling concludes, not after purchase orders are signed. One observed listing carries a CE marking claim, and another references CDP as a standard entry; buyers should ask each supplier to state precisely which standard the marking refers to and to supply the corresponding certificate or test report with a verifiable issuing body. For pet carriers sold into regulated markets, general product safety obligations apply even where no pet-specific carrier standard exists, so documentation of material safety — particularly for fabrics and coatings that animals will contact — is a reasonable request.

Buyers should also verify internal quality grading claims. Listings observed in this category include a "1grade" quality entry, which is a supplier self-assessment rather than an independent result; ask what inspection criteria sit behind it. Request material safety data or composition declarations for the polyester and any PVC components, especially for EU or North American retail programs where chemical content scrutiny is increasing. Finally, confirm that any certification shown on a listing applies to the exact model number you intend to order, since certificates are frequently issued per model or per material batch and do not automatically transfer across a supplier's catalog.

Cost Drivers and Commercial Terms

Price dispersion in the observed range — USD 2.62 to 30.5 — is driven mainly by material construction, size tier, and customization depth. A one-size, non-customized stock carrier in basic polyester sits at the low end, while larger sizes, PVC-coated fabrics, needled cotton linings, and private-label branding push costs upward. Net weight differences from roughly 0.23 kg to 0.95 kg per unit also matter: heavier carriers raise per-unit freight, and packing formats observed range from polybag to carton, with one listing specifying 20 pieces per carton box, which affects container loading calculations.

Commercial terms should be negotiated with equal discipline. Observed payment terms are T/T and PayPal; buyers should agree on deposit proportions and balance timing in writing, and align payment method with order size, since PayPal suits samples and small trial orders while T/T is standard for production runs. Delivery time observations span 5–7 days for stock items and 7–15 days more broadly, so distinguish stock-led replenishment from made-to-order production in your planning. MOQ observations of 1 to 1,000 units mean sample orders and volume orders coexist in this category; confirm where your chosen model's MOQ sits before quoting landed cost.

Supplier Qualification and Quality Control

Supplier qualification starts with entity type. Observed listings identify the seller as a manufacturer with origin in Tianjin, China and more broadly China, and one listing advertises OEM factory service — signals that direct production relationships are available. Buyers should confirm whether the counterparty is the actual manufacturer or a trading intermediary, since this affects customization capability, defect accountability, and pricing headroom. Request factory information, production capacity statements, and references to prior pet-carrier programs, and validate that the OEM service covers your intended branding, packaging, and size requirements.

Quality control should be built into the order, not assumed. Require a pre-production sample for the exact model number, then define an inspection checklist covering seam integrity, waterproofing behavior at seams and zips, strap and buckle strength against the stated 3–10 kg capacity range, zipper cycling, and colorfastness for the chosen colorway. For first production orders, consider third-party inspection before shipment, particularly for customized runs where rework is costly. Agree in writing on the acceptable defect rate, the packing standard — whether polybag or carton, and pieces per carton — and the remediation process for goods that fail inspection at destination.

Long-Term Procurement Checks

Long-term sourcing success in this category depends on treating initial orders as the start of a managed program. Reconfirm specifications at every reorder, because polyester sourcing, coating weights, and lining materials are common substitution points when suppliers face cost pressure; a "same model" shipment can quietly differ from the approved sample. Track delivery-time performance against the observed 5–7 day stock and 7–15 day production windows, and hold suppliers to agreed tolerances so your inventory planning stays reliable across peak pet-travel seasons.

Also review commercial and compliance posture annually. Revalidate certificates against current model numbers, since design changes can invalidate CE or other documentation claims, and update chemical-compliance declarations when materials change. Monitor whether customization terms, MOQ thresholds, and packing configurations remain stable as your volumes grow — growing buyers often earn better terms, but only if they renegotiate with data. Finally, maintain a documented spec sheet per model, including net weight, size tier, color codes, and waterproofing method, so that any alternate supplier can be benchmarked against your current product rather than against a generic category description.
